3D Printing in Dental Surgery



To boost the field of oral surgery, you can check out the subtopic of 3D printing in oral surgery. This cutting-edge innovation has the prospective to change the way oral doctors run and deal with patients. Right here are four crucial ways in which 3D printing is forming the field:

- ** Customized Surgical Guides **: 3D printing permits the production of very precise and patient-specific medical overviews, enhancing the accuracy and performance of treatments.

- ** Implant Prosthetics **: With 3D printing, oral specialists can create personalized dental implant prosthetics that perfectly fit a client's one-of-a-kind makeup, leading to far better outcomes and individual contentment.

- ** Bone Grafting **: 3D printing makes it possible for the manufacturing of patient-specific bone grafts, decreasing the need for typical grafting methods and boosting recovery and recuperation time.

- ** Education and Training **: 3D printing can be utilized to produce sensible medical versions for academic functions, enabling dental doctors to practice complex treatments before executing them on clients.

Minimally Intrusive Techniques



To even more advance the field of dental surgery, embrace the potential of minimally invasive techniques that can significantly benefit both surgeons and people alike.

Minimally invasive strategies are revolutionizing the field by reducing surgical trauma, minimizing post-operative pain, and speeding up the healing procedure. These strategies include using smaller incisions and specialized tools to carry out treatments with precision and performance.

By using sophisticated imaging innovation, such as cone beam computed tomography (CBCT), cosmetic surgeons can precisely prepare and perform surgical treatments with very little invasiveness.

In addition, using lasers in oral surgery enables accurate tissue cutting and coagulation, leading to minimized blood loss and decreased healing time.

With minimally invasive strategies, people can experience quicker healing, minimized scarring, and improved results, making it an essential facet of the future of oral surgery.
